Select dates so you can see the availability and exact prices.
62, George Borg Olivier Street, Saint Julian's
Main Street 48, St. Julians, Mt, Stj1017, Saint Julian's
Triq E. Bradford, NXR 2216 Naxxar, Malta, Naxxar
Dun Guzeppi Xerri, STJ 1420 St. Julianʼs, Malta, Saint Julian's
116 Mons G Depiro Street, SLM 2031 Sliema, Malta, Sliema
Triq Id-Dris, SWQ 3727 St. Julianʼs, Malta, Swieqi
Triq Santa Lucija 138, NXR 1500 Naxxar, Malta, Naxxar